Output 26593542961914079e943938cc4826af647898f434f437b390936bc5038580ce:46

value
1543000
script pubkey
OP_0 OP_PUSHBYTES_20 d4ef8c1fed1b7cd7b455c305bce7e48877ea2ac7
address
bc1q6nhcc8ldrd7d0dz4cvzmeely3pm752k8q36080
transaction
26593542961914079e943938cc4826af647898f434f437b390936bc5038580ce
spent
true